Experience the natural beauty of Aintree-Eglinton Reserve, located in the heart of Perth. This 8.0-acre park offers a serene and picturesque ambiance, making it the ideal destination for walkers and hikers. With its lush greenery and tranquil atmosphere, the park provides a rejuvenating escape for those seeking an active outdoor experience. Aintree-Eglinton Reserve provides a range of activities for visitors, including walking and running trails that cater to all fitness levels. Perth's mild climate makes this park an inviting destination for outdoor enthusiasts throughout the year. Whether you prefer a leisurely stroll or a challenging hike, the park's diverse landscapes and well-maintained paths offer a rewarding experience for all. Aintree-Eglinton Reserve, located in Perth, Australia, offers a picturesque setting for walking and running enthusiasts. With essential amenities such as picnic sites, BBQ facilities, and drinking water, this park provides a convenient and enjoyable experience for visitors looking to engage in outdoor activities. The serene surroundings and well-maintained trails make it an ideal location for individuals seeking a refreshing and revitalizing walking or running session. Whether you're a seasoned runner or someone who simply enjoys a leisurely walk, Aintree-Eglinton Reserve has something to offer for everyone. The park's natural beauty and accessibility make it a prime destination for those looking to engage in physical activity amidst a tranquil environment.

FAQs About Aintree-Eglinton Reserve
Are there facilities or amenities for walkers/runners in Aintree-Eglinton Reserve?
Yes, Aintree-Eglinton Reserve provides essential amenities such as picnic sites, BBQ facilities, and drinking water, making it convenient for walkers and runners to enjoy their activities in the park.
How accessible is Aintree-Eglinton Reserve?
Aintree-Eglinton Reserve is accessible and welcoming to walkers and runners, with well-maintained paths and facilities that cater to their needs.
What kind of sports can I do in Aintree-Eglinton Reserve?
In Aintree-Eglinton Reserve, walkers and runners can engage in various sports activities such as jogging, running, and other outdoor exercises, taking advantage of the beautiful natural surroundings and amenities available in the park.
What is the best season to walk in Aintree-Eglinton Reserve?
The best season to walk in Aintree-Eglinton Reserve is typically during the spring and autumn months when the weather is mild and the flora is in full bloom.
What are the typical weather conditions to prepare for in Aintree-Eglinton Reserve?
Aintree-Eglinton Reserve experiences hot, dry summers and mild, wet winters. Visitors should prepare for hot temperatures and potential bushfire risks in the summer, and cooler temperatures with occasional rainfall in the winter.
What kind of wildlife might you encounter in Aintree-Eglinton Reserve?
Aintree-Eglinton Reserve is home to a variety of wildlife, including kangaroos, wallabies, native birds, and reptiles. Visitors may also encounter echidnas, possums, and various species of insects and butterflies while walking or running in the reserve.
